Clemson Football team to be honored on Senate floor |
WASHINGTON, DC - U.S. Senators Tim Scott (R-SC) and Lindsey Graham (R-SC) will go to the Senate floor today to congratulate the Clemson University football team on their win over the University of Alabama in the 2017 College Football Playoff National Championship.
